Шаговая система программного управления манипулятором

 

О П И С А Н И Е () 746433

ИЗОБРЕТЕН ИЯ

Союз Советских

Социалистических

Республик

К АВТОРСКОМУ СВИДЕТЕЛЬСТВУ -".!д 3 !!,.ЫИ3 (6! ) Дополнительное к авт. свил-ву (22)Заявлено 10.04.78 (2! ) 2602029/18-24 (51)М. Кд.

G 05 В 19/40

В 25 J 9/00 с присоединением заявки №

Государственный комнтет

СССР (23) Приоритет

Опубликовано 07,07.80,. Бюллетень № 25 но делам изобретений н открытий (53) Л К 62-50 (088.8) Дата опубликования описания 07 07.80 (72) Автор изобретения

В. С. Громосяк с

Проектно-конструкторское и технологическое бюро по машиностроению (7! ) Заявитель (54) ШАГОВАЯ СИСТЕМА ПРОГРАММНОГО УПРАВЛЕНИЯ

МАНИПУЛЯТОРОМ

Изобретение относится к автоматике и вычислительной технике и может быть использовано при создании импульсных систем программного управления манипулятором.

Известны шаговые системы программного управления манипулятором, содержащие блок

5 памяти, блок записи, блок воспроизведения, блок формирования команд коммутатор, ша-. говый двигатель и датчик положения (1J.

Однако, они имеют сложную структуру при

t0 реализации их на двоичных логических элементах.

Наиболее близким техническим решением к данному. изобретению является система, содержащая последовательно соединенные блок !

5 памяти, первый ключ, блок воспроизведения программы и блок управления, первый и второй выходы которого подключены к соответствующим входам первого коммутатора, выход которого соединен со входом шагового

20 двигателя, связанного через исполнительный оргав с датчиком положения исполнительного ор.гана, последовательно соединенные второй коммутатор, первый элемент задержки, первый элемент ИЛИ и блок записи программы, выход которого подключен ко второму входу первого ключа, второй выход второго коммутатора подключен ко второму входу первого элемента ИЛИ, третий вход которого соединен с первым выходом второго коммутатора (2J.

Недостатком этой системы является ее невысокая точность, особенно лри больших скоростях, вследствие инерционности исполнительного органа и возможных потерь импульсов шаговым двигателем. Цель изобретения — повышение то пюсти системы.

Поставленная цель достигается тем, что система содержит второй ключ. последовательно соединенный второй элемент задержки, реверсивный счетчик, первый дешифр;пор, генератор импульсов и второй элемент ИЛИ и последовательно соединенные второй дешифратор и элемент И, второй вход которого подключен ко входу второго элемента задержки и третьему выходу блока управления, а выходко второму входу второго элемента ИЛИ, 746433 4

15

35

55 выход которого соединен с третьим входом первого коммутатора, вход второго ключа подключен к выходу датчика положения исполнительного органа, первый выход -- ко входу второго коммутатора, а второй выход — ко второму входу реверсивно . го счетчика, выход которого соединен со входом первого и второго дешифраторов.

На чертеже представлена функциональная схема системы (по одной координате манипулятора) .

Она содержит блок 1 йамяти, первый ключ

2, второй ключ 3, блок 4 записи программы,. блок 5 воспроизведения программы, блок 6 управления, первый коммутатор 7, шаговый двигатель 8, исполнительный орган 9, датчик 10 положения исполнительного органа, второй коммутатор 11, первый элемент 12 задержки, первый элемент 13 ИЛИ, блок 14 коррекции, реверсивный счетчик 15, второй элемент 16 задержки, первый дешифратор 17, второй дешифратор 18, второй элемент 19 ИЛИ, генератор

20 импульсов, элемент 21 И.

Шаговая система работает следующим образом.

При установке ключей 2 и 3 в положение

"запись" и перемещении рабочего органа по требуемой траектории импульсный датчик 10 положения действительного положения формирует импульсы, которые через второй коммутатор 11, первый элемент 12 задержки и первый элемент 13 ИЛИ поступают в блок 4 записи.

В результате в блок 1 памяти записываются все перемещения исполнительного органа 9, по каждой координате на отдельную дорожку магнитной ленты. Сигналы прямого перемещения записываются одиночными импульсами, а сигналы обратного перемещения — двойными.

Для воспроизведения программы устанавливают ключи 2 и 3 в положение "работа". Считаннь е блоком 5 воспроизведения импульсы поступают на блок 6 управления, который формирует команды управления первым коммута тором 7 (прямое и обратное перемещение) и импульсные последовательности, соответствующие перемещением, которые через блок 14 коррекции поступают на информационный вход коммутатора 7 шагового двигателя и далее отрабатываются шаговым двигателем 8. С импульсного датчика 10 положения на вычитающий вход реверсивного счетчика 15 поступают импульсы, соответствующие действительным перемещениям исполнительного органа 9. На суммирующий вход реверсивного счетчика 15 поступают задержанные вторым элементом 16 задержки импульсы программы. Время задержки выбирается соответствующим инерционности шагового - двигателя 8 и исполнительного органа 9, поэтому при точном воспроизведении программы реверсивный счетчик 15 находится в нулевом состоянии, В случае, если число импульсов, поступивших на вычитающий вход, меньше числа импульсов, поступающих на суммирующий вход, что свидетельствует об отставании исполнительного органа 9, например из-за потерь импульсов гцаговым двигателем, реверсивный счетчик

15 (в данном примере шестиразрядный) устанавливается последовательно в состоянии

000001, 000010, 000011 и т.д., что выявляется первым дешифратором 17, который включает генератор 20 импульсов. Импульсы коррекции с генератора 20 импульсов поступают через второй элемент 19 ИЛИ вместе с импульсами программы на первый коммугатор 7 и отрабатыва ются шаговым двигателем 8. Импульсы коррекции выдаются генератором 20 импульсов до тех пор, пока не будет обнулен реверсивный счетчик 15 (ошибка скорректирована). В слу- чае, если имеет место пробег исполнительного органа 9, соответствующей разностью импульсов реверсивный счетчик 15 устанавливается последовательно в состояния 111111, 111110, 111101 и т.д. Такие состояния счетчика выявляются вторым дешифратором 18, на инверсном выходе которого исчезает сигнал и элемент 21 И запирается, предотвращая подачу следующих импульсов программ на шаговый двигатель 8 до тех пор, пока ими не будет скомплексирована ошибка (счетчик 15 обнулился).

Применение изобретения позволит повысить точность позиционирования манипулятора.

Формула изобретения Яаговая система программного управления манипулятором, содержащая последовательно соединенные блок памяти, первый ключ, блок воспроизведения программы и блок управления, первь1й и второй выходы которого подключены к соответствующим входам первого коммутатора, выход которого соединен со входом шагового двигателя, связанного через исполнительный орган с датчиком положения исполнительного органа, последовательно соединенные второй коммутатор, первый элемент задержки, первый элемент ИЛИ и блок записи программы, выход которого подключен ко второму входу первого ключа, второй выход второго коммутатора подключен ко второму входу первого элемента

ИЛИ, третий вход которого соединен с первым выходом второго коммутатора, о г л и ч а ющ а я с я тем, что, с целью повьпцения точности системы, она содержи г в горо " ключ, последовательно соединенные второй н емент задержки, реверсивный счетчик, первь|й дешифратор, генератор импульсов и BToi ой элемент

746433 6 ко второму входу реверсивного счетчика, выход которого соединен со входом первого и второго дешифраторов.

Источники информации, принятые во внимание при экспертизе

1. Шадрин В. Н. Фазовое управление от магнитной ленты, М-Л. "Энергия", 1964, с. 14.

2. Авторское свидетельство СССР. цо заявке p N 2520536/18-24, 05.09.77 (прототип) .

Составитель Г. Нефедова

Техред И.Асталош

Редактор И. Ковальчук

Корректор И. Муска

Заказ 4102/16 Тираж 95б Подписное

ЦНИИЧИ Государственного комитета СССР по делам изобретений и открытий

l l3035, Москва, Ж-35, Раушская наб., д. 4!5

Филиал ППП "Патент", г. Ужгород, ул. Проектная, 4

ИЛИ и последовательно соединенные второй дешифратор и элемент И, второй вход которого подключен ко входу второго элемента задержки н третьему выходу блока управления, l а выход — ко второму входу второго элемента

ИЛИ, выход которого соединен с третьим входом первого коммутатора, вход второго ключа подключен к выходу датчика положения ислолчительного органа, первый выход — ко входу второго коммутатора, а второй выход—

I

I

1 !

Шаговая система программного управления манипулятором Шаговая система программного управления манипулятором Шаговая система программного управления манипулятором 

 

Похожие патенты:

Изобретение относится к контролю стрельбы отвернутым способом по воздушным целям на тактических учениях

Изобретение относится к системам программного управления упаковочной техникой и может быть использовано для автоматизации процесса маркировки, наклейки этикеток, акцизных марок на предметы прямоугольной формы, в частности при нанесении акцизных марок на пачки сигарет

Изобретение относится к станкостроению и может быть использовано для контроля работы и диагностики функциональной надежности технологического оборудования типа металлорежущих станков

Изобретение относится к сельскому хозяйству и может быть использовано в сельскохозяйственных машинах для автоматизации точного локального внесения удобрений и посадочного материала по программе, например, задаваемой положением лункообразователя, при посеве и посадке различных сельскохозяйственных культур

Изобретение относится к средствам для установки шин на колесные диски

Изобретение относится к шинной промышленности и может быть использовано при изготовлении разнотипных шин

Изобретение относится к управлению метеорологической защитой и может быть использовано для активного воздействия на атмосферные процессы с целью изменения погодных условий

Изобретение относится к технике испытания и контроля систем или их элементов
Наверх